MIRROR MAGIC - Product Information

This Ultrasonic Vehicle Reversing Safety Device has been engineered with the highest available technology and has been designed to help the driver be in better control when reversing. When the car approaches an object in the detection zone, an alarm sounds, this alarm increases its intensity as your vehicle moves closer to the object, it also simultaneously displays the direction and distance of the object.

This allows the driver to have better control when parking in tight spaces and greatly improving safety and judgement.

OPERATING METHODS


When in reverse, the system sounds a beep to indicate that the sytem is now active.

The sensors will now start to detect any object within the first detection zone (within1.6m(5.0ft) distance) and start to sound alarm, The second zone is detected at 1.0m(3.0ft) and the third zone at 0.6m(2.0ft), the alarm
increases its intensity as the object passes through each zone.
Finally from 0.4m(1.0ft) the alarm will sound continually indicating the driver to stop.

For the driver with hearing problems the display shows visually the actual distance is 0.1m(0.5ft). This system also indicates the closest side to an object left or right.
